Roll20 Enhancement Suite 使用教程
1. 项目的目录结构及介绍
Roll20 Enhancement Suite 是一个用于 Roll20 平台的非官方增强工具,旨在提升用户体验和工作流程。以下是其主要目录结构及介绍:
roll20-enhancement-suite/
├── css/
│ ├── main.css
│ └── ...
├── js/
│ ├── main.js
│ └── ...
├── lib/
│ ├── some-library.js
│ └── ...
├── README.md
└── ...
- css/: 包含项目使用的所有 CSS 文件。
- js/: 包含项目使用的所有 JavaScript 文件。
- lib/: 包含项目依赖的第三方库文件。
- README.md: 项目的说明文档。
2. 项目的启动文件介绍
项目的启动文件主要是 js/main.js
和 css/main.css
。这两个文件是项目运行的核心文件,负责初始化和加载所有必要的资源。
- js/main.js: 这是 JavaScript 的主文件,包含了项目的初始化代码和主要逻辑。
- css/main.css: 这是 CSS 的主文件,定义了项目的样式和布局。
3. 项目的配置文件介绍
Roll20 Enhancement Suite 的配置文件主要是 config.json
,它位于项目的根目录下。这个文件包含了项目的所有配置选项,如 API 密钥、用户设置等。
{
"apiKey": "your-api-key",
"userSettings": {
"theme": "dark",
"language": "zh-CN"
}
}
- apiKey: 用于与 Roll20 API 进行通信的密钥。
- userSettings: 包含用户自定义的设置,如主题和语言。
通过以上介绍,您可以更好地理解和使用 Roll20 Enhancement Suite 项目。希望这份教程对您有所帮助!